Performance and Efficiency Comparison



When comparing air resource and ground source heat pumps for efficiency and performance, it's essential to think about exactly how each system operates in various conditions. Air source heatpump draw out warmth from the outdoors air, making them much more vulnerable to variations in temperature. This indicates they could be much less effective in exceptionally cold environments.

On the other hand, ground source heat pumps make use of stable underground temperatures for warmth exchange, providing even more regular performance despite outside weather. heatpumps are usually a lot more energy-efficient in the long run due to the stable heat source underground. Furthermore, ground resource heatpump tend to have a longer life expectancy contrasted to air resource heatpump, which can influence long-lasting efficiency and upkeep prices.

Cost Analysis: Installment and Maintenance



For an extensive comparison between air resource and ground source heat pumps, it's important to examine the prices connected with their installment and upkeep. Air resource heat pumps generally have lower upfront installment expenses compared to ground resource heatpump. who services heat pumps near me of air source heatpump involves less complex excavation and exploration, making it an extra budget-friendly option for lots of home owners.



Nevertheless, ground source heat pumps are recognized for their greater performance, which can result in reduced long-term power costs, potentially countering the first installment costs over time.

When it involves maintenance costs, air source heatpump are usually much easier and cheaper to preserve contrasted to ground resource heat pumps. Ground source heatpump need periodic checks on the below ground loop system, which can incur added maintenance expenditures.

On the other hand, air resource heatpump usually need basic filter modifications and occasional expert evaluations, keeping maintenance expenses relatively low.

Consider both the in advance installation expenses and long-lasting upkeep costs when making a decision between air source and ground source heatpump to establish which choice aligns finest with your budget and requirements.

Environmental Effect Evaluation



Examining the environmental effect of air source and ground resource heat pumps is vital in comprehending their sustainability.

Air resource heat pumps call for electricity to run, which can bring about raised carbon emissions if the power comes from nonrenewable fuel sources. On the other hand, ground resource heat pumps utilize the steady temperature level of the ground to warm and cool your home, causing reduced energy usage and decreased greenhouse gas emissions.

The setup of both sorts of heat pumps entails some level of environmental effect, such as making use of cooling agents in air resource heat pumps or the excavation needed for ground loopholes in ground source heat pumps. However, ground source heatpump have a longer lifespan and higher performance, making them a much more environmentally friendly alternative over time.
